This is the MCX platform chambered in 7.62 NATO, wearing the full-length M-LOK handguard and a Magpul MOE SL-M stock that folds to the side for transport. You get the short-stroke gas piston system that made the MCX line famous, plus an ambidextrous side charging handle working alongside the rear AR-style charger. That dual setup matters when an optic crowds the upper rail, because you can run the bolt without breaking your firing grip. The Nightforce ATACR 1-8x24 F1 sits up top in a Nightforce one-piece mount, color-matched to the rifle, with a Cloud Defensive LCS feeding a SureFire M640 Turbo Scout up front. Flip-up backup irons fold flat under the glass.
The pistol is the part that turns heads. It is a P226 X-Five Tactical, built in the SIG Mastershop in Eckernforde and stamped Made in Germany on the slide. The single-action target trigger, the beavertail, the threaded barrel, and the X-Five grip frame all carry the same FDE coat as the rifle. A SureFire X300 Turbo rides the dust cover. It ships with its factory SIG case, a spare magazine, and the German factory test target signed by the test shooter.
